A management plan is being developed for an area which has had a decrease in plant species which support an endangered animal species. The plan is to increase the amount of primary producers to allow this area to thrive without further human interaction. Which of these best describes this plan?
Parasitism
Mutualism
Partnership
Sustainability
Answer explanation
The plan is to make it so the ecosystem can maintain itself, remaining in balance without humans. This is a plan with sustainability in mind.

A glacier has moved, revealing bare rock with no soil present. Lichens begin growing on the rock. As they break the rock down, soil is made. Grass and flowering plants grow in this soil. Which species mentioned is the pioneer species?
Soil
Grasses
Flowering plants
Lichens
Answer explanation
This is an example of primary succession. In primary succession, the first species to grow is the pioneer species. In this case, lichens grew first, so they are the pioneer species. Lichen are able to grow in many places, making them a common pioneer species.

Which plant would have low nitrogen requirements?
Wheat
Barley
Legumes
Corn
Answer explanation
Legumes have the ability to fix nitrogen, meaning they would not need nitrogen available in the soil.
